Analysis of ENTRAILED BY YOU.

Kennedy Mwangi 1998 (Nairobi)



With lips like those all I want to do is just kiss you,
The more I  kiss you the more I just miss you,
Every time I miss you I just wish I was with you,
Whenever I'm with you I just keep thinking of you,
The more I think of you the more I feel love for you,
The love I feel for you just makes me adore you,
I adore you for I have been impressed by you,
You are so impressive that my heart beats for you,
With every beat my heart grows fond of you,
 I am fond of you for I see no one else but you,
Every time I see I just want to do things to you,
Things that will surely excite and also amaze you,
Amazing is the life that I want to have with you,
With you by my side is the life I want with you.
